In this episode of the Integral Yoga Podcast, Avi Gordon (director of the Integral Yoga Teachers Association) is in conversation with Pamela Seelig. Pamela began practicing Yoga more than 25 years ago when an illness interrupted her Wall Street career. She started meditating as a complementary therapy which led to a lifelong pursuit of perceiving yogic wisdom. Pam is certified to teach Integral Yoga Hatha, Raja and meditation instructor. In this conversation, she talks about her transition from studio owner to author of a new book, Threads of Yoga.
